Does your infant demand to be rocked to rest by you or awaken in the center of the evening demanding a breast, bottle or cuddle before wandering back to rest? If your kid is at least 4 months old, it may be time to start rest training. By that age, children can and need to be able to sleep or drop back to sleep on their very own by self-soothing.

What sleep training isn't Initial, rest training and evening discouraging do not necessarily go hand-in-hand. That's one of numerous means that rest training is not as rough as it sounds.

When to start rest training, Professionals suggest starting sleep training when infants are 4 to 6 months old. This age range is the sweet area, considering that infants are old sufficient to literally make it for 6 to eight hrs overnight without requiring to consume yet aren't quite at the factor where the calming you give has ended up being a rest association.

The Ferber Method The Ferber Approach is comparable to Weep It Out, but a lot more gradual, for this reason its labels of "graduated termination," dynamic waiting, as well as the interval method. With this technique, parents adhere to the same routine of taking their baby through a going to bed ritual, cuddling them as well as kissing them goodnight, and then leaving the area and closing the door.

The Ultimate Guide To Night Terrors

After the initial couple of nights, parents progressively raise the amount of time they let the infant cry before reentering the area, ultimately getting to a factor where the baby self-soothes. This technique charms to parents that are unpleasant with the black-and-white nature of the CIO technique, however some still feel it can be shocking for the child.

If you choose this method, know that your infant will weep at some factor as well as you won't be able to respond. If that makes you unpleasant, think about one more technique.
